Managing Driving for Work

Driving for work involves a risk not only for drivers, but also for fellow workers and members of the public such as pedestrians and other road users who share the road space. Code of Practice for the Design and Installation of Anchors

This code of practice particularly applies to the design and installation of anchors that are used in Safety Critical Situations. The European Technical Approval guideline documents define Safety Critical Situations as being ‘where the failure of such connections where the failure of such connections would cause risk of human injury or death.
